About this school


Castle Hill Primary School is a community school located in Basingstoke, within the Hampshire local authority. The school plays an important role in the local community and forms part of the state funded education system in England.

The school educates mixed pupils aged 4 to 11. It currently has 646 pupils on roll with space for 660, offering a broad curriculum across all primary year groups.

The most recent Ofsted inspection, published on 23 January 2024, rated the school Outstanding. Inspectors highlighted the overall quality of education and the strong relationships between staff and pupils.
